AIDSO members and students protest against closure of courses

Chandil: Members of All India Democratic Students Organization (AIDSO), Chandil unit, put up a demonstration at Chandil to protest the closure of PG and B.Sc courses at Kasi Sahu College, Seraikela, Baharagora College and Chakradharpur College on Saturday.

Raising slogans against the vice chancellor of Kolhan University RPP Singh, the protestors alleged that the neglect of KU officials had led to the current situation. They said the students of the region will suffer due to the closure of the courses. The university officials should take a decision to start the courses in the larger interest of the students, they said.

�It is indeed disappointing to know that the university has decided to close down the courses. There are a large number of students in Seraikela, Baharagora and Chakradharpur. But sadly enough, the authorities concerned did not think a while about their future. The state government should take measures to solve the crisis and restart the courses at the earliest,� said Anant Kumar Mahato, district secretary of the organization.

Dr Gurupad Rajwar, principal of Singhbhum College, said the PG courses were being run with the help of contract and guest teachers. He said the college had little to do as the decision to close down the courses had been closed following the directive of the university authorities concerned.

A large number of students participated in the protest. They threatened to wage an indefinite agitation in case the courses were not restarted soon.
